Because of these different degrees of coupling to ambient conditions, trees will be
affected to greater extent when temperatures change than low-stature vegetation. The
temperature of low-stature plants also varies greatly with topography (orientation to
the sun, slope, shelter), and microhabitats differing in temperature by several Kelvin
may be found within a meter from each other. These small-scale thermal mosaics
contrast with the common isotherm-oriented scenarios of those models that model
vegetation as driven by climatic changes or which simulate climatic change effects
on vegetation or with large-scale natural thermal gradients
